英文摘要
In eukaryotic cells, aberrant mitochondria are selectively removed by a process called mitophagy, and PINK1 and Parkin, causative gene products for Parkinsonism, mediate this process in mammalian cells while yeast cells lack the Parkin-PINK1 system. Here we expressed Parkin and a PINK1 fusion protein that is artificially targeted to the mitochondrial outer membrane in yeast cells. Parkin expressed in the cytosol was recruited to the mitochondrial outer membrane by PINK1 in a manner that depends on the kinase activity of PINK1. The recruited Parkin was further phosphorylated and ubiquitinated like the case for mammalian cells. The yeast cells with artificially expressed Pakin-PINK1 can thus offer a useful tool to analyze the functions of the Parkin-PINK1 system.
